NBC interviewer Marv Albert, responding to charges by Jim Rice of the Boston Red Sox that he asked only negative questions during a nationally televised interview, said another approach would have made the program “a jerky show.”

“I know he wasn’t happy, but I don’t know what he’d expect to be asked,” Albert said of last Saturday’s pregame interview.

Rice, who had a shoving match with Manager Joe Morgan earlier this season, lost patience when Albert brought up the player’s recent failure to answer a curtain call after a home run at Fenway Park.
